Ackman’s Howard Hughes plans won’t affect Pershing Square’s investment strategy

Summary by Hedgeweek
Bill Ackman, the founder of hedge fund Pershing Square, has clarified that his plans to transform Howard Hughes Holdings into a diversified holding company will not interfere with how his existing portfolios manage their stakes in other companies, according to a report by Reuters.
